-1

モカで非同期テストを実行できません。

これが私のコードです

describe('Brightcove Wrapper',function(){
    describe("#init()", function() {
        it("Should inject the brightcove javascript", function(done){
            BCL.init(function(){
                //expect(window).to.have.property('brightcove');
                console.log(this) //window object
                done();
                console.log('this shows in the log too')
            });
        });
    });
})

両方のログが表示されますが、done() は呼び出されません。

4

1 に答える 1

-1

私の関数では、ドキュメントの本文に文字列を追加していましたが、これは明らかにモカを混乱させます。ID を持つ div に文字列を追加するようにコードを変更し、テストに合格しました。

于 2013-02-19T16:57:36.950 に答える